Quezon City Mayor Joy Belmonte warned that social unrest may arise should the government prolong the implementation of strict quarantine rules in the country.
Belmonte on Friday said she is in favor of easing quarantine restrictions, especially in cities like Quezon City, “which is very, very big,” as social unrest may be triggered by hunger and poverty.

“I’m open to (easing quarantine rules)… We always say that we have to balance health and economy. But in a city like Quezon City, which is very, very big, we have another problem that I’d like to raise: the issue of social unrest,” Belmonte said in a forum hosted by the National Press Club of the Philippines.
